Abstract

In this paper, the authors are willing to study the effects of unified power flow controller (UPFC) on voltage support and also stability enhancement at a multi-machine electric power system. Proportional-Integral (PI) type controllers are considered for UPFC control and the parameters of these PI type controllers are tuned using simulated annealing (SA).  In order to show the ability of UPFC in voltage control and also stability enhancement, the results of the system with UPFC are compared with the results without UPFC. Nonlinear time domain simulation results emphases on the ability of UPFC in simultaneous control of voltage and also stability enhancement
